Class: Google::Apis::AndroidmanagementV1::Policy
- Inherits:
-
Object
- Object
- Google::Apis::AndroidmanagementV1::Policy
- Includes:
- Core::Hashable, Core::JsonObjectSupport
- Defined in:
- generated/google/apis/androidmanagement_v1/classes.rb,
generated/google/apis/androidmanagement_v1/representations.rb,
generated/google/apis/androidmanagement_v1/representations.rb
Overview
A policy resources represents a group settings that govern the behavior of a managed device and the apps installed on it.

#auto_time_required ⇒ Boolean Also known as: auto_time_required?
Whether auto time is required, which prevents the user from manually setting
the date and time.
Corresponds to the JSON property autoTimeRequired
2058 2059 2060 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/androidmanagement_v1/classes.rb', line 2058 def auto_time_required @auto_time_required end |
#block_applications_enabled ⇒ Boolean Also known as: block_applications_enabled?
Whether applications other than the ones configured in applications are
blocked from being installed. When set, applications that were installed under
a previous policy but no longer appear in the policy are automatically
uninstalled.
Corresponds to the JSON property blockApplicationsEnabled
2067 2068 2069 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/androidmanagement_v1/classes.rb', line 2067 def block_applications_enabled @block_applications_enabled end |

#frp_admin_emails ⇒ Array<String>
Email addresses of device administrators for factory reset protection. When
the device is factory reset, it will require one of these admins to log in
with the Google account email and password to unlock the device. If no admins
are specified, the device won't provide factory reset protection.
Corresponds to the JSON property frpAdminEmails
2176 2177 2178 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/androidmanagement_v1/classes.rb', line 2176 def frp_admin_emails @frp_admin_emails end |

#kiosk_custom_launcher_enabled ⇒ Boolean Also known as: kiosk_custom_launcher_enabled?
Whether the kiosk custom launcher is enabled. This replaces the home screen
with a launcher that locks down the device to the apps installed via the
applications setting. The apps appear on a single page in alphabetical order.
It is recommended to also use status_bar_disabled to block access to device
settings.
Corresponds to the JSON property kioskCustomLauncherEnabled
2216 2217 2218 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/androidmanagement_v1/classes.rb', line 2216 def kiosk_custom_launcher_enabled @kiosk_custom_launcher_enabled end |

#network_escape_hatch_enabled ⇒ Boolean Also known as: network_escape_hatch_enabled?
Whether the network escape hatch is enabled. If a network connection can't be
made at boot time, the escape hatch prompts the user to temporarily connect to
a network in order to refresh the device policy. After applying policy, the
temporary network will be forgotten and the device will continue booting. This
prevents being unable to connect to a network if there is no suitable network
in the last policy and the device boots into an app in lock task mode, or the
user is otherwise unable to reach device settings.
Corresponds to the JSON property networkEscapeHatchEnabled
2275 2276 2277 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/androidmanagement_v1/classes.rb', line 2275 def network_escape_hatch_enabled @network_escape_hatch_enabled end |
